Introduction & Clinical Importance
Multiple Sclerosis (MS) is a chronic autoimmune disease damaging the central nervous system, causing fatigue, mobility issues, vision problems, and cognitive challenges. Treatments like disease-modifying therapies (DMTs), stem cell therapy (e.g., aHSCT, MSC), and rehabilitation slow progression and improve quality of life.
